Raja Games Colour Prediction Violation

The Raja Games’s core offering directly conflicts with existing legislation.

According to legal scholars, colour prediction mechanics constitute gambling activities.

  1. The Public Gambling Act, 1867 – This central legislation prohibits gambling houses and public betting across India. 
  2. State-Specific Gambling Laws – According to regional legal frameworks, states like Tamil Nadu,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, and Karnataka have explicitly banned online betting and gambling activities. Raja Games violates these specific state regulations.

Colour prediction involves zero skill; outcomes depend entirely on chance. This classification makes such activities illegal gambling.

How Raja Games Evades Legal Action?

According to cyber law enforcement officials, such platforms employ specific evasion tactics:

  • Multiple Domain Strategy – Raja Games operates across various web addresses. When authorities block one, alternatives remain functional.
  • Offshore Server Hosting – Servers likely operate outside Indian jurisdiction. This complicates immediate legal action.
  • Anonymous Ownership Structure – According to corporate transparency norms, legitimate businesses reveal ownership. 

According to cyber police reports, these tactics temporarily delay enforcement but don’t establish legality. Eventually, such platforms face blocking and prosecution.

Comparison with Legal Gaming Platforms

Legitimate skill-based gaming platforms operate differently. According to legal gaming industry standards, proper platforms:

  • Display valid licenses prominently
  • Register with the appropriate authorities
  • Implement KYC (Know Your Customer) protocols
  • Comply with tax regulations
  • Provide transparent dispute resolution
  • Publish verifiable ownership details

Raja Games satisfies zero criteria from this checklist. The contrast confirms illegal operations.

How to Report Raja Games?

Encountered Raja Games or similar platforms?

According to legal experts, reporting helps enforcement:

  • File a Complaint in Cyber CrimeFile complaints specifying illegal gambling operations
  • State Police Cyber Cells – Contact local cyber police with platform details and transaction evidence
  • RBI Banking Ombudsman – Report suspicious payment gateway usage for illegal activities
  • Ministry of Electronics and IT – Submit blocking requests for illegal gaming websites

According to authorities, public complaints expedite investigation and blocking procedures.
